Lens error i have a nikon coolpix l2 and i was taking a pic from a sunset. but after that, the lens wont retract or go back to its normal position when off. it just stuck and i cant do anything coz it says LENS ERROR. How can i solve this problem? please help thanks

I had the same problem....my problem was the lens was pushed forward and the third zoom was pushed back. so the lens is blocking the cover(thing that covers the lens) so push the lens back carefully with a cottom swab and pull the third zoomer thingy out.

Lens Error on NIkon CoolPix L2

Lens error is usually caused by mechanical faults concerning lens assembly. The lens cannot extend or retract fully, the error is detected and lens error is returned.
Sometimes this can be fixed playing with the lens during extraction or retraction to help the lens asset getting back to normal.
More often the camera lens must be disassembled and re-assembled by a technician to fix the problem.
